Description
The Edwards 302-194 is a commercial conventional heat detector designed for use with compatible conventional fire alarm systems. It features 194°F (90°C) fixed-temperature activation with rate-compensation technology, allowing the detector to respond more quickly to rapidly rising temperatures while minimizing thermal lag under normal operating conditions.
Designed for demanding commercial and industrial environments, the detector is self-restoring, hermetically sealed, shock resistant, corrosion resistant, and tamper resistant. Its rugged construction makes it suitable for indoor applications where elevated ambient temperatures require a higher-temperature heat detector. Electrical & System Information
The 302-194 is a conventional normally open heat detector designed for use on supervised initiating device circuits. When the detector reaches its rated activation temperature, the internal contacts close to signal an alarm condition to the compatible fire alarm control panel.
The detector operates without electronic circuitry and automatically resets after temperatures return below the operating threshold, eliminating the need for manual reset following non-destructive activation.

Mounting & Design
The Edwards 302-194 is designed for surface mounting and installs directly to the protected surface without requiring a separate back box for standard indoor applications.
Its compact metal housing provides dependable performance in commercial and industrial environments while allowing fast installation and long service life. Additional weatherproof, box-mount, and hazardous-location versions are available within the Edwards 302 Series for specialized applications.

Technical Specifications
Manufacturer: Edwards
Series: 302 Series
Model: 302-194
Product Type: Conventional Heat Detector
Detection Method: Rate Compensation Fixed-Temperature Heat Detection
Temperature Rating: 194°F (90°C)
Contact Configuration: Normally Open
Reset Type: Automatic Self-Restoring
Operating Voltage: 6–125 VAC
Operating Voltage (DC): 6–25 VDC
Maximum DC Voltage: 125 VDC
Minimum Ambient Temperature: –40°F (–40°C)
Maximum Ceiling Temperature: 150°F (65.6°C)
Construction: Hermetically Sealed
Resistance Features: Shock Resistant, Corrosion Resistant, Tamper Resistant
Mounting: Surface Mount
Application: Indoor Commercial Fire Alarm Systems
Listings: UL Listed and MEA Approved (application dependent). Verify product labeling and local code requirements before installation.
